Kainotomic evaluation

Qwen3.6-27B-FP8 has credible 27B-class capability evidence: official materials document image, text, and video input; text output; function calling; structured output; and a native 262k context window, with self-hosted extension to about 1M tokens. Its reported 77.2% SWE-bench Verified result supports a coding score above GPT-5.6 Luna’s 78 only narrowly, but it remains below Kimi K2.5 (86) and Claude Opus 4.8 (95), which have stronger broader agentic evidence. Artificial Analysis’ Intelligence Index of 37 does not justify a high reasoning score. Multimodal I/O is comparable to Kimi K2.5 and above Luna, given documented image and video inputs, but below Gemini 3.5 Flash’s 92 because the supplied evidence does not establish similarly broad modality quality. At a reported $0.61 blended per-million-token price through DeepInfra FP8, cost efficiency exceeds Luna’s 86-calibrated profile. Official Model Studio pricing, limits, tool support, plus vLLM/SGLang OpenAI-compatible examples make pricing and developer experience relatively strong. Reported throughput near 58–59 output tokens/s and 1.07-second TTFT support an above-median speed score. Evidence quality is moderate rather than leading: the key SWE-bench claim is vendor-reported, while third-party performance and pricing are provider-specific. No matching DeepSWE result or Arena coding-preference rank was found. LiveCodeBench, Terminal-Bench, and Aider were checked, but supplied sources provide no usable exact-model results; adoption therefore remains below established frontier API models.

Strengths

  • Officially documented multimodal inputs, 262k context, function calling, and structured output.
  • FP8 weights with vLLM and SGLang OpenAI-compatible serving paths.
  • Low reported blended inference price and strong reported serving throughput.
  • Vendor-reported 77.2% SWE-bench Verified result for the underlying 27B model.

Caveats

  • SWE-bench evidence is provider-reported and FP8 equivalence is stated rather than independently benchmarked.
  • Artificial Analysis measurements and price reflect a specific DeepInfra FP8 deployment, not every endpoint or self-hosted configuration.
  • The supplied evidence does not provide exact-model LiveCodeBench, Terminal-Bench, Aider, DeepSWE, or Arena results.
